First of all, this is not a $200 show. Depending on the number of people, I'd top off the price at $60. There is no really big illusion, and it is a relatively short show. I would spend more time on getting some more tricks to add, or a large illusion.
An illusion doesn't have to be 100's of dollars. My best trick cost me around $25 for instructions and materials. I use Andrew Mane's Bisection. Very inexpensive and gets great reactions.
1. Go with appearing cane. I wouldn't make the hankerchief reappear, as it appears it turns into the cane.
2. Next do the rope trick. Do Equal-Unequal Ropes (Like $3) It's a good litlle rope trick that I use in my shows.
3.
Add in another trick. My suggestion is a change bag effect. I'd buy a change bag and either make up a routine or buy a Blendo silk set. You can doI nice torn and restored newspaper routine with it witch I sometime use. With a change bag the possiblities are endless.
4.
Add in another trick. My suggestion is sponge balls. Since you have a ton of time, I'd buy some and learn the sleights for them. Practise every day for maybe 20 minutes and you'll have them down in a week. Get a sponge video for routines. I have "25 tricks with Sponge Balls".
5. Now do PB&J. I don;t add in the bonus trick (the making of a PB&J sandwitch). I just create comedy by pretending not to know about them switching.
6. D'lite Routine. Do your routine. Don't personally use them but my friend does. Cool to at the end change the light into that color silk.
7. Zombie. I let it "pull me around the stage" or performance area. Good reactions from it.
8. Illusion or large climax. Finish with a big trick. Like an escape (Mail Bag Escape) or Bisection, or any big or dangerous trick (Portable Sawing In Half, Sphere, any ANdrew Mane). Or if you don't have one skip this. I recomend a big climax trick though.
9. End with the dissapearing cane. Yes, it's a great idea.
